The WDM system supports two transmission modes: single-fiber unidirectional and single-fiber bidirectional. Simple design and low requirements. Easy fault isolation. In fiber optics, Understand What Does Bidirectional Mean Firstly, bidirectional refers to the ability to transmit and receive data over the same fiber strand but in opposite directions. This is achieved using Wavelength Division Multiplexing (WDM), where each direction uses a different wavelength. An Optical Transceiver Module, commonly known as a transceiver or optics, is a device that uses optical technology to send and receive data over fiber optic cables. It converts electrical signals into optical signals for transmission and optical signals back into electrical signals for reception.

    The RFoG WDM module is designed to satisfy wavelength management requirements where 1310, 1490, 1550 and 1590 / 1610nm wavelengths are used in passive optical network applications. This unit is available in traditional LGX module packaging with virtually all connector options.     The QDCO1 operates at 28Gbaud and supports 100Gb/s tunable WDM transmission in the compact and popular QSFP28 pluggable form-factor, with low power consumption of <6Watts and support for 100GE and OTN clients. Our pluggable coherent optical modules support a variety of data rates, including 100Gb/s and 400Gb/s to enable application optimization based on capacity, distance and port type. In this. QSFP28 is the main form factor for 100G optical modules. This article reviews QSFP28 module types and key WDM technologies like CWDM and DWDM. The high bandwidth QSFP28 module supports 2 km and 10 km links over single-mode fiber via LC connector in. A 100G optical module is a high-speed communication device designed for data centers and telecommunication networks, capable of supporting transmission rates of 100 Gbps.
